Adobe buys Pixmantec

The latest news of the day, and worthy of posting, is that Adobe (www.adobe.com) has purchased Pixmantec (www.pixmantec.com) which is in no doubt an effort to pull the throes of people who use the Pixmantec RawShooter into their fold. Pixmantec published a press release on their web site, which states, in part that:

“With high quality digital cameras now within reach of every photographer, customers are gravitating to RAW file formats that allow them to get more control over final results,” said John Loiacono, senior vice president of Creative Solutions at AdobeĀ®. “By combining Pixmantec’s raw processing technology and expertise with our own, we’re continuing to deliver on the promise that even your existing RAW files can be processed with increasing quality as our software technology evolves.”

While this is clearly an effort to woo the aspiring prosumer market, for whom the costly Photoshop Creative Suite 2 (retails at $649) and purchasable from Adobe directly from ther website here, is out of reach, one can hardly blame them for finally taking more than a passing interest in the “lower echelons” of the photography market.
